Abstract:
OBJECTIVE To optimize the extraction process of standard decoction of Longan seed. METHODS The amount of water added, extraction time and extraction times as the influencing factors, using the extract yield, gallic acid content, corilagin content, ellagic acid content, half clearance concentration (IC50) of 1,1-diphenyl-2-picryl-hydrazyl (DPPH) free radical and IC50 of 2,2′-azino-bis (3-ethylbenzothiazoline-6-sulfonic acid) ammonium salt (ABTS) free radical as the evaluation indexes, the analytic hierarchy process (AHP), criteria importarue though inter-criteria correlation (CRITIC) and AHP-CRITIC method were used to calculate the weight values of each index; the extraction process of Longan seed standard decoction was optimized by single factor test combined with orthogonal experiment; validation test was also performed. RESULTS According to the AHP-CRITIC method, the weights of the above indicators were determined to be 9.224%, 11.784%, 19.320%, 11.206%, 20.597%, 27.869%, respectively. The best process of standard decoction of longan seed was to add 14 times water for the first extraction and extract for 30 minutes; and 12 times water for the second and third extractions, and extract for 20 minutes. Average comprehensive score of the 3 times validation experiments was 97.96 and the RSD was 0.97% (n=3). CONCLUSIONS The process is simple to operate, stable and feasible, which can provide a experimental basis for the further development and utilization of standard decoction of longan seed.
